The Director General of The Gambia Radio and Television Services (GRTS), Malick Jones, who was appointed by the former president, is removed from his position and redeployed as deputy permanent secretary at the ministry of information and communication infrastructure (MoICI), according to a source.

The source revealed that Bai Sanyang, the deputy director general, is now overseeing the institution.

Mr. Jones was appointed on the 19 December 2016 after the declaration of the results of the presidential election in which the former president was defeated.

The veteran broadcaster was the deputy permanent secretary at the ministry of information and communication infrastructure (MoICI), before his appointment as GRTS DG.

Sources also revealed that he is redeployed to his former position as DPS at the same ministry.

In 2011, Mr Jones has served as deputy Director General of GRTS until 2013 when he became the acting GRTS DG. Later in that year, he was appointed as the deputy permanent secretary at MoICI until his transfer to head GRTS replacing Lamin Manga.
